Major Russia-Ukraine Prisoner Swap Announced

Major Russia-Ukraine Prisoner Swap Announced

News EditorBy News EditorMay 23, 2025 World 5 Mins Read

A substantial prisoner exchange is reportedly happening between Russia and Ukraine, marking a critical development in the ongoing conflict. This announcement follows direct negotiations held in Turkey, indicating potential avenues for future discussions. While the Ukrainian official has described the swap as incomplete, significant media coverage suggests optimism regarding its implications for broader peace talks.

Context of the Prisoner Swap: Ongoing War and Negotiations

The context surrounding the recent prisoner swap is grounded in the ongoing war between Russia and Ukraine, which has intensified significantly since its inception. The exchange involves around 1,000 prisoners of war from both sides, indicating a monumental effort to address humanitarian issues amid a heated conflict. Russian and Ukrainian officials engaged face-to-face negotiations for the first time in many months, with Turkey serving as a neutral venue for these discussions.

Reports from various officials have confirmed that this is one of the key outcomes of the negotiations held in Turkey. During these discussions, both sides openly addressed the dire needs of their respective populations while navigating the intricacies of warfare and diplomacy. The prisoner swap is not only a practical step to reunite families but also holds symbolic significance that could pave the way for future dialogues aimed at ending the hostilities.

Reactions from Key Leaders: Responses to the Negotiations

In the wake of the prisoner swap news, prominent political figures have shared their thoughts on the negotiations.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y highlighted the importance of the agreement, indicating that the release of captives was a major win amidst an otherwise challenging situation. On social media, he stated, “The agreement to release 1,000 of our people from Russian captivity was perhaps the only tangible result of the meeting in Turkey.”

Meanwhile, former President Donald Trump chimed in on the negotiations, declaring the swap as “a major prisoners swap” through a social media post. He lauded both parties for their efforts and expressed hope that this development may lead to larger discussions about a ceasefire, underscoring the potential for diplomatic solutions in the ongoing crisis.

Ceasefire Prospects: Steps Towards Ending Hostilities

The possibility of a ceasefire remains a crucial point of discussion following the recent negotiations. Although both sides agreed to the prisoner exchange, there remains uncertainty about whether a formal ceasefire can be achieved. Amid the ongoing discussions, Russian President Vladimir Putin acknowledged that a ceasefire is a feasible goal but emphasized that compromises need to be made by both nations.

Kremlin spokesperson Dmitry Peskov remarked that no direct peace talks had been scheduled following the prisoner swap, indicating a cautious approach ahead. Despite this uncertainty, there are indications from both sides that further negotiations may be forthcoming to establish a more permanent resolution.
